The Field Service Technician applies mechanical aptitude to perform maintenance and repairs to all heavy equipment rentals and scissor lift equipment in the shop and at customer job sites; applies troubleshooting techniques and determines proper repair procedures; prepares parts requisitions. Essential Functions Perform maintenance and repairs on a variety of rental and customer heavy equipment with precision and expertise. Diagnose and repair mechanical and electrical issues on-site or in the shop. Travel to customer jobsites to provide top-notch repair and maintenance services. Must have excellent troubleshooting and analytical skills. Must have intermediate mechanical aptitude. Must be able to perform repairs safely. Must be able to work independently and as part of a team. Must be able to interact professionally with customers and all levels of personnel within the organization. Must be a strong communicator with excellent verbal and written skills. Must be self-directed and well organized with the ability to prioritize workload while providing excellent customer service. Demonstrates ability to learn and apply new knowledge. Proficient in use of technical software, databases and manuals. Must be able to function well in a fast-paced environment. Must be able to work any shift and overtime as needed to meet business and customer demands. Promote positive customer experience. Excellent communication skills. Other job tasks and functions as assigned.
